Formed from nymphomaniac + -al, after nymphomania. Nymphomania combines Greek nymphe, 'young woman or bride,' with mania, 'madness.' Once treated as a medical diagnosis for supposedly excessive female desire, the term is now dated, gendered, and often offensive; nymphomaniacal commonly survives as a hyperbolic insult.
